Energy storage systems can save you money in a variety of ways. By storing energy during off-peak hours (when electricity is cheaper) and using it during peak demand times (when electricity is more expensive), you can lower your electricity bills. A 3-kilowatt (kW) solar system has become a common choice for homeowners looking to significantly offset their electricity costs, representing a practical entry point into energy independence. This size of system is often suitable for small to medium-sized homes with moderate energy usage.

How Much Sun Do You Get (Peak Sun Hours). The strength of the sunlight, the angle of the sun, and temperature can all affect how much power your solar panel produces.
